Commit Graph

21 Commits

Author SHA1 Message Date
Aran-Fey 753132718d fix typescript warning about override of state 2024-10-04 15:04:57 +02:00
Jakob Pinterits 9e78d62698 JavaScript now also uses double quotes in strings 2024-09-26 19:37:51 +02:00
Jakob Pinterits 0da463a03a added missing supercalls and related fixes 2024-07-27 20:02:37 +02:00
Jakob Pinterits f003e47157 reworked popup manger (breaks dropdowns) 2024-07-25 20:46:59 +02:00
Jakob Pinterits de1f73b13f rio.Popup now supports displaying no background 2024-07-21 20:02:49 +02:00
Jakob Pinterits e9f979611d popups now have a "fullscreen" + popup bugfix 2024-07-21 19:23:04 +02:00
Aran-Fey 42294fc70b fix popups always being visible 2024-06-29 15:23:33 +02:00
Aran-Fey 7d329db85c misc fixes 2024-06-18 21:46:06 +02:00
Aran-Fey 0cdc77dace fix various single-containers 2024-06-18 21:34:25 +02:00
Aran-Fey fe5c5abfa6 remove JS layouting 2024-06-18 21:33:29 +02:00
Jakob Pinterits 0d9a67998a popup, calendar & date input tweaks 2024-06-02 09:50:35 +02:00
Jakob Pinterits 6d5c04bb62 tooltips now use the new popup manager & accept a gap value 2024-06-01 00:08:17 +02:00
Jakob Pinterits e3f983dea9 added new PopupManager 2024-05-31 22:04:54 +02:00
Aran-Fey b8e87b7309 add infrastructure for deprecated parameter names 2024-05-25 10:40:17 +02:00
Jakob Pinterits 86081613ae bugfix: progress circles weren't visible 2024-05-06 15:07:23 +00:00
Jakob Pinterits 683aa530eb improved theme context switching 2024-05-03 11:12:27 +02:00
Jakob Pinterits b10560ba9b WIP: new switcheroo system 2024-05-03 10:40:34 +02:00
Jakob Pinterits 5fb516f6aa work on the new theming system 2024-04-21 15:03:47 +02:00
Jakob Pinterits c93c314d3a more link fixes; renamed replaceFirstChild 2024-04-14 14:26:46 +02:00
Jakob Pinterits 0e41143d95 updated icons page in the debugger 2024-04-07 15:31:06 +02:00
Aran-Fey d5e02c3c52 initial commit 2024-04-03 19:23:29 +02:00